Icon What Are KPIs?

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are measurable metrics that show how effectively you’re reaching your goals. In digital and email marketing, KPIs move beyond vanity numbers like total subscribers—they track what directly impacts your bottom line.

Think of KPIs as the vital signs of your marketing health. They answer questions like: “Is my campaign resonating with my audience?” or “How well is my strategy converting leads into customers?”

Icon Essential Email Marketing KPIs

  • Open Rate: % of recipients who open your email. Benchmark: 15–25%.
  • Click-Through Rate (CTR): % of opens that click links. Benchmark: 2–5%.
  • Conversion Rate: % of clicks leading to desired actions. Benchmark: 1–5%.
  • Bounce Rate: % of emails not delivered. Keep under 2%.
  • Unsubscribe Rate: % of users opting out. Keep under 0.5%.
  • List Growth Rate: Net increase of subscribers. 2–5% monthly is healthy.

Icon Key Digital Marketing KPIs

  • Traffic Sources & Acquisition Cost: Know where leads come from and how much they cost.
  • Engagement Metrics: Time on site, pages per session—key for post-click analysis.
  • Return on Ad Spend (ROAS): Track ad revenue per $ spent.
  • Customer Lifetime Value (CLV): Predict long-term revenue from each customer.
  • Churn Rate: Measure customer loss and use re-engagement campaigns to fight it.

Icon How to Measure & Track KPIs

  • Set clear goals: e.g., “Increase CTR by 20% in Q4.”
  • Use the right tools: Email automation, analytics platforms, dashboards.
  • Segment data: Track by audience, device, or campaign type.
  • Monitor in real time: Pause campaigns if bounce rates spike.
  • Benchmark & analyze trends: Compare against industry and your past results.
  • Report & iterate: Monthly reports keep your team aligned.

Icon Best Practices to Optimize KPIs

  • Personalize: Dynamic content lifts open rates by 18%.
  • Optimize for mobile: Nearly half of emails are opened on mobile.
  • Send at the right time: Peak hours like Tuesday at 10AM can lift opens by 20%.
  • Run A/B tests: Test subject lines, CTAs, and layouts.
  • Clean your list: Regularly remove inactive or invalid contacts.
  • Integrate channels: Combine email with SEO, paid ads, and social.
